WebFor assets purchased under Hire Purchase arrangement, you can claim for 100% of the principal paid (plus deposit amount if any). B. 3 Year Write Off Method Effective YA2009, all assets can use the 3 Year Write Off method to claim CA. The CA per year computed is simply cost of assets divide by 3. WebHire purchase is an installment-based method of procuring expensive consumer goods or assets. This method is used both by individuals and firms. The buyer makes a down payment —a partial sum or a percentage of the total price. The remaining amount is paid in installments—inclusive of interest.
